1.Construction and expression of eukaryotic expression vector of human IL-37 b gene
Jing YAO ; Jiang CHENG ; Xuefeng PEI ; Jingyu WANG ; Ming YUAN
Acta Laboratorium Animalis Scientia Sinica 2016;24(3):268-272
Objective To construct the eukaryotic expression vector pEGFP-N1/IL-37b and analyze the expression of IL-37 gene in THP-1 cells. Methods Total RNA was extracted from human peripheral blood mononuclear cells ( PB-MCs) and the coding region of IL-37b gene was amplified by RT-qPCR. Then, the gene was cloned into pEGFP-N1 eu-karyotic expression vector. After transfected the recombinant plasmid into THP-1 cells, the expression of IL-37 was detec-ted by RT-qPCR and Western blot. Results Double restriction enzyme digestion and gene sequencing showed that IL-37b gene was correctly inserted into the eukaryotic expression vector pEGFP-N1. RT-qPCR and Western blot showed that the IL-37 expression level was increased significantly (P<0. 01) after transfection in THP-1 cells. Conclusions We successful-ly constructed a novel anti-inflammatory cytokine IL-37 eukaryotic expression vector pEGFP-N1/IL-37b, which lays a foun-dation for further study on IL-37 functions and its association with related diseases.
2.Relationship between family function and self-esteem in college students
Jingyu SHI ; Lu WANG ; Yuhong YAO ; Na SU ; Fazhan CHEN ; Xudong ZHAO
Chinese Journal of Behavioral Medicine and Brain Science 2015;24(3):247-249
Objective To explore the association between family function and self-esteem in college students.Methods Totally 2560 college students were sampled.They were assessed with the self-compiled questionnaire on family information,Rosenberg' s self-esteem scale (SES) and family assessment device (FAD).Results The students from only-child family (30.32±4.19) scored higher on SES than students with siblings (29.54±3.97).The students with experience of grandparents raising (29.84±4.19) scored lower on SES than students raised by parents (30.29±4.13).Students from harmonious family and with monthly incoming above 10000 Yuan scored higher on SES than other groups.All the differences were statistically significant (P<0.01,P<0.05).There was significant correlation between SES and all of the dimensions of FAD (r=-0.260-0.379,P=0.000).Multiple regression showed that such dimensions of FAD as role,communication,behavior control,problem solving and general functioning,as well as social economic status of the family played important role on self-esteem of the students(β=0.039-0.169,P<0.01 orP<0.05).Conclusion Family factors have significant impact on self-esteem of the college students,especially family role and communication which are important positive predictors on self-esteem of college students.
3.Effects of Honokiol on Proliferation and Apoptosis on U937 Cells
Fang XUE ; Zhiyong CHENG ; Lin YANG ; Shihui LI ; Jingyu ZHANG ; Li YAO ; Ling PAN
Journal of Sun Yat-sen University(Medical Sciences) 2009;30(4):408-412
[Objective] To investigate the anti-proliferative and apoptosis effect induced by Honokiol (HNK) on human myeloid leukemia cell line U937 cells in vitro.[Methods] After treated with different concentration of HNK,Hoechst33342 fluorescent staining was used to detect cell apoptosis;the growth inhibition ration of U937 cells and PBMCs were analyzed by MTT assay;the apoptosis ration was detected by flow cytometry;mitochondrial membrane potential was explored by rhodamine 123 stain;Caspase3/7 protein activity kit was used to test the Caspase3/7 activity;the Caspase-3 and Caspase-7 mRNA levels were detected by real-time fluorescent relative-quantification reverse transcriptional PCR (FQ-PCR).[Results] Honokiol could significantly inhibit the proliferation of U937 cells in terms of the indexes of IC50/U937 11.8 μg/mL and IC50/PBMCs 40.3 μg/mL,and the anti-proliferative effect was in a time and concentration dependent manner;Flow cytometry analysis manifested that Honokiol could induce U937cells apoptosis by Annexin V/PI double Annexin V/PI fluorescein stain;Honokiol significantly inhibited the mitochondrial membrane potential of U937 cells and enhanced the ability of Caspase3/7 and the mRNA expression levels,but not the PBMCs.[Conclusion] HNK can inhibit U937 cells proliferation and induce cells apoptosis via activating Caspase 3/7.
4.Analysis of the correlation between the knowledge of smoking/smoking cessation, the compliance of smoking cessation and fasting plasma glucose in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us
Yao TANG ; Yingyue DONG ; Jingyu ZHANG
Chinese Journal of Modern Nursing 2014;20(10):1120-1124
Objective To understand the master condition of knowledge of smoking /smoking cessation in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us , and to analyze the correlation between the knowledge of smoking /smoking cessation , the compliance of smoking cessation and fasting plasma glucose in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us .Methods The knowledge of smoking/smoking cessation and the compliance of smoking cessation were surveyed by the questionnaire in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us .The average of fasting plasma glucose during 12 months in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us was longitudinally observed through the prospective randomized study . The correlation between the knowledge of smoking/smoking cessation , the compliance of smoking cessation and fasting plasma glucose was analyzed by the statistical analysis .Results Two hundred and twenty pat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us were interviewed , and 193 patients including 100 cases with smoking and 93 cases with non-smoking finished the follow-up study.The score of the knowledge of“smoking is harmful to the diabetes” was (18.30 ±6.07), and was lower than the scores of knowledge of smoking cessation (19.81 ±4.94) and “smoking is harmful to health” in all patients, and the difference was statistically significant ( P<0 .05 ) , but no difference was found in the smoking group and non-smoking group (P>0.05).The difference was found in the fasting plasma glucose in the smoking group and non-smoking group one month after the treatment (P=0.29).The average score of compliance of smoking cessation in the smoking group was (2.14 ±0.88) one month after the treatment, and was better than (2.52 ±1.04) six months after the treatment and (2.68 ±1.12) twelve months after the treatment , and difference was statistically significant (P<0.01).No correlation was found in scores of the knowledge of smoking /smoking cessation and the compliance of smoking cessation in the smoking group (P>0.05); there was the correlation between the compliance of smoking cessation and the number of smoking before the treatment , the average fasting plasma glucose every month after the treatment;there was the correlation between the scores of knowledge of smoking /smoking cessation and history of smoking (P<0.05).Conclusions The pat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us do not fully master the knowledge of smoking cessation;the smoking can affect the control level of fasting plasma glucose to a certain extent , but is not the decisive factor; the knowledge of smoking/smoking cessation is separate from the behavior of smoking/smoking cessation .The compliance of smoking cessation in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us can be improved through guiding the content and mode of health education in the future using the related psychological mechanism of decision-making behavior , strengthening the behavior training , and actively guiding the participation of families and other supervision .
5.Progress of genomics and targeted therapy in osteosarcoma
Jingyu HOU ; Chuchu WANG ; Weitao YAO
Cancer Research and Clinic 2020;32(9):658-662
Osteosarcoma is a highly malignant bone tumor that predominantly affects children and adolescents. Standard chemotherapy currently used is usually poor, with a lower survival rate of patients with recurrence or metastasis. And it is necessary to find precise targeted therapy drugs from a genic perspective. This paper reviews the progress of genome research on germline mutation and somatic mutation of osteosarcoma in recent years, summarizes mutations and pathways that are closely related to osteosarcoma and can reflect the characteristics of osteosarcoma in order to provide a hope for the next generation of molecular targeted therapy.
6.Free medial plantar artery perforator flap for soft tissue defect reconstruction of the weight-bearing surface of the heel
Huishuang DONG ; Wanxi ZHANG ; Jun YAO ; Hongyu HU ; Yunpeng ZHANG ; Jingyu ZHANG ; Zhiliang YU ; Shunhong GAO
Chinese Journal of Plastic Surgery 2021;37(12):1378-1381
Objective:To investigate the clinical application of the free medial plantar artery perforator flap for soft tissue defect reconstruction of the weight-bearing surface of the heel.Methods:The clinical data of patients with soft tissue defects in the weight-bearing surface of the heel were analyzed retrospectively, which were reconstructed with the free medial plantar artery perforator flaps in the Second Hospital of Tangshan from April 2011 to November 2017. The medial plantar artery was anastomosed with the posterior tibial artery. The venae comitantes were anastomosed with the great saphenous vein. The cutaneous branch of the medial plantar nerve was also anastomosed with the saphenous nerve. The donor sites were covered with full-thickness skin grafting. The survival condition, sensory function, countour, stability, and donor site scars were observed during follow-up.Results:A total of 11 patients with soft tissue defects in the weight-bearing surface of the heel were enrolled. There were six males and five females aged 24-41 years (mean, 31.3 years). All flaps survived uneventfully. Patients were followed up 11-56 months (mean 18.5 months). The appearance and function recovery of the flaps were satisfactory with 6-13 mm two-point discrimination(2-PD). No ulcer occurred. All patients returned to a normal walk.Conclusions:It is a feasible way for one-staged reconstruction of the combined loss of Achilles tendon and soft tissue in the heel by using free anterolateral femoral artery perforator flap with fascia lata, which has the advantages of good functional recovery, less trauma, short curing course, the satisfactory contour, and protective sensation achievable.

8.Expression and significance of HIF-1α and VEGF in liver tissues after ischemia-reperfusion injury in rats
Yuxiang HAN ; Shanshan OU ; Xiaoyu XIAO ; Jingyu YAO ; Lukun YANG
Chinese Journal of Hepatic Surgery(Electronic Edition) 2015;(5):314-317
ObjectiveTo investigate the expression and significance of hypoxia-inducible factor (HIF)-1α and v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) in liver tissues after ischemia-reperfusion injury (IRI) in rats.MethodsSixteen Sprague-Dawley (SD) rats were randomized into the IRI group and the Sham group according to the random number table, 8 rats in each group. The portal vein and branches of hepatic artery of the rats in the IRI group were clamped with the atraumatic vascular clamp. After 45 min of ischemia, reperfusion was performed for 6 h. The porta hepatis of rats in the Sham group was exposed and the hepatic blood flow was not occluded. The morphological changes of the liver tissues in two groups were observed. The serum alanine aminotransferase (ALT) and aspartate aminotransferase (AST) were tested and the contents of HIF-1α and VEGF in liver tissues were determined. Data comparison between two groups was conducted usingt test.ResultsUnder light microscope, swelling, vacuolar degeneration of the liver cells, inflammatory cell infiltration, hepatic sinusoidal dilatation, disorganized hepatic cords and spotty necrosis were observed in the IRI group. The histomorphology of liver tissues in the Sham group was normal. The serum ALT and AST in the IRI group was respectively (1 007±130) and (1 307±72) U/L, which were significantly higher than (59±4) and (81±3) U/L in the Sham group (t=20.700, 48.448;P<0.05). The relative expression of HIF-1α and VEGF in liver tissues of IRI group was 1.77±0.10 and 1.86±0.05 respectively, which were significantly higher than 0.60±0.22 and 0.83±0.06 in the Sham group (t=13.623, 35.563;P<0.05).ConclusionThe expression of HIF-1αand VEGF in liver tissues increase significantly during early IRI, which may play a role in reducing the IRI of organism.
9.Application of Eurorad database in the teaching of radiology in standardized residency training: A case study of teaching film-reading
Jingyu ZHONG ; Qinhua MIN ; Caisong ZHU ; Zhenmin JIANG ; Yifan WANG ; Huan ZHANG ; Weiwu YAO
Chinese Journal of Medical Education Research 2024;23(1):134-139
The teaching of radiology in standardized residency training needs a large number of case data to strengthen the subjective understanding and awareness of residents. The database built by residency training bases can meet the needs of teaching to a certain extent, but the conditions of training bases vary across regions, which makes it difficult to achieve homogeneity in the teaching of radiology. This article discusses the application of Eurorad database in the teaching of radiology in standardized residency training. This database is free of charge, reliable, and comprehensive and provides a large number of free reliable cases and images for teaching, covering both common and rare diseases. Moreover, it can also be used to cultivate the English ability and comprehensive quality of residents and help to establish a hierarchical training system for radiology and non-radiology residents, thereby promoting the improvement in the quality of standardized residency training. This article shows the potential value of Eurorad database in the teaching of radiology in standardized residency training, and comparative studies are needed in the future to further prove its effectiveness.
10.A single-center retrospective study of relationship between 25 hydroxyvitamin D3 level and global registry of acute coronary event score in elderly patients with acute coronary syndrome
Hairui SHAO ; Chenxi SHEN ; Yao LI ; Jingyu WANG ; Ying LIU ; Lei LYU
Chinese Journal of Postgraduates of Medicine 2024;47(10):893-897
Objective:To investigate the relation between 25 hydroxyvitamin D3 level and global registry of acute coronary event (GRACE) score in elderly patients with acute coronary syndrome (ACS).Methods:The clinical data of 120 elderly male patients with ACS hospitalized in the General Hospital of Eastern Theater Command from January 2020 to June 2022 were retrospectively analyzed. Clinical characteristics of patients were collected and the 25 hydroxyvitamin D3 level was assessed with the chemiluminescent immunoassay method. According to GRACE score, the patients were divided into intermediate-risk group (109 to 140 scores, 46 cases) and high-risk group(>140 scores, 74 cases). The severity of coronary lesion was assessed according to the results of coronary angiography (CAG) and then they were divided into A, B, C group. The independent influential factors of GRACE score were analyzed by Logistic regression analysis.Results:The level of 25 hydroxyvitamin D3 in the high-risk group was lower than that in the intermediate-risk group: (13.84 ± 3.42) μg/L vs. (18.57 ± 5.17) μg/L, the usage rate of angiotensin-converting enzyme inhibitors (ACEI)/angiotonin receptor blocker (ARB) in the high-risk group was lower than that in the intermediate-risk group: 17.6%(13/71) vs. 41.3%(19/46), there were statistical differences ( P<0.05). Logistic regression analysis showed that 25 hydroxyvitamin D3 level was the risk factor for GRACE score ( OR = 0.745, 95% CI 0.657-0.844, P<0.05). The level of 25 hydroxyvitamin D3 had negative correlation with the severity of coronary lesion ( P<0.05). Conclusions:The level of 25 hydroxyvitamin D3 has correlation with GRACE score and the severity of coronary lesion in elderly patients with ACS.
